‘I’m speaking right now!’ Kamala Harris lashes out at heckler at Detroit dinner with Octavia Spencer despite mourning loss of ‘innocent lives’ in Gaza after Israeli hostage rescue

Deputy Director Kamala Harris lashed out at a pro-Gaza protester on Saturday after mourning the loss of civilian lives Gaza during the war with Israel.

Harris addressed the ongoing conflict during her speech in Michigan Democratic Party Legacy Fundraising Dinner in Detroit.

When the vice president said she and the president were working to end the war between Israel and… Hamasa woman stood up and started yelling at Harris.

“I’m speaking now,” Harris said sternly, as security moved quickly to push the protester out of the room. “I appreciate and respect your voice, but I’m speaking now.”

Harris on Saturday celebrated the news that Israel had rescued four hostages, but acknowledged that many civilian lives were lost during the operation.

“Fortunately, four of those hostages have been reunited with their families tonight,” she said. “And we mourn all the innocent lives lost in Gaza, including those who tragically died today.”

Israelis celebrated after four of the hostages captured and held by Hamas on October 7 were rescued as part of an Israeli military operation.

The freed hostages were Noa Argamani, 26, Almog Meir Jan, 22, Andrei Kozlov, 27, and Shlomi Ziv, 41.

Gaza’s Ministry of Health said The Israeli hostage rescue operation killed 274 Palestinians, but the Israeli estimated the list of victims was fewer than 100.

Harris defended the Biden administration’s approach to the Israel-Gaza war.

“We have worked every day to end this conflict in a way that keeps Israel safe, brings all hostages home, ends the ongoing suffering for the Palestinian people and ensures Palestinians can enjoy their right to self-determination, dignity and freedom. ‘ she said.

President Joe Biden and Harris are struggling with support from Michigan Arab-American communities, who are angry at the way the government is supporting Israel during its war with Hamas.

The Biden campaign also continues to grapple with disruptions by protesters at campaign events calling the president “Genocide Joe” and the vice president “Killer Kamala.”

Harris was also harassed by pro-Gaza protesters on Tuesday during an appearance for a taping of Jimmy Kimmel’s late night show.

‘You’re a fucking murderer! How many babies have you killed?’ shouted one protester as the show started.

The protests were removed from the show when it aired, but anti-war activists from Code Pink published them on YouTube.

Thousands of angry pro-Palestinian protesters gathered at the White House on Saturday, demanding that Biden push for a ceasefire in Gaza.

A protester wearing a Hamas headband held up a bloodied face mask of President Biden as they called for an end to the war. Other protesters defaced a statue in Lafayette Park with angry messages aimed at Biden.

The president was in France during the protest.

During her dinner speech, Harris praised Biden’s negotiations with Qatar and Egypt to pressure Israel to offer a ceasefire in Gaza and withdraw completely from the area.

“As President Biden said last week, it is time for this war to end,” she said.

Harris spent the day in Michigan, where she attended a fundraising event in Ann Arbor where she mocked former President Donald Trump.

Actress Octavia Spencer joined Harris for her events, including a stop at a bookstore in Ypsilanti, Michigan.

Spencer praised Biden and Harris for helping the Black community, pointing out that they sent them direct payments from the government as part of the coronavirus relief bill.

“One of the first things Joe and Kamala did when they came to power was deliver checks directly into the pockets of millions of Americans,” she said. “$1,400 American Rescue Plan checks and another $300 per month per child per family.”

Harris took a shot at former President Donald Trump, referring to the New York jury’s verdict on 34 felony convictions in the “hush money” trial.

‘Do you know why he’s complaining? Because the reality is that cheaters don’t like being caught,” she said.

Harris criticized Trump for describing the verdict as politically motivated.

“Simply put, Donald Trump thinks he’s above the law. “This should be disqualifying for anyone who wants to be president of the United States,” she said.
